This interesting proposal of Arsis Produccions Musicals presents a different way of seeing on stage one of the most important works of world literature and at the same time, the world of cinema sound.
Through the theatrical performance of Don Quixote de la Mancha adapted for children, we discover how the different effects of cinema occur, which in English is called Foley in honor of George Foley. They can hear and see how the sounds of footsteps of a horse, swords, a fall, or the bleating of sheep are imitated. Children will also participate and help to imitate the sound of rain, hail, thunder and lightning. A very funny at the same time instructive show for people of all ages.
It is presented within the program of children's and youth shows TotiMOLT 2015-2016 of the Palma City Council. Recommended for children from 5 years.
